Rocking "T" Knife


The Rocking "T" Knife allows easy cutting of meat and other foods for people with a weak grasp or the use of only one hand. This stable, easy-to-use utensil cuts food with a rocking motion and because pressure is applied directly above the food to be cut, less strength and dexterity is needed by the user.

The Rocking "T" Knife is highly recommended and has the most comfortable grip, compared to similar knives we have seen. Its 4" wooden handle is shaped to fit the hand. The 3 1/2" stainless steel blade may be sharpened with a knife sharpener.

Dishwasher safe up to 125°F. Latex free.

This rocker knife is the only style worth spending money on if the person can only use one hand for feeding themselves. By pushing down directly on top, the grip doesn't have to be as tight as with a handled knife. We have two for my Mom, one with table-knife sharpness and one with steak-knife sharpness for meats, etc. (This model is the sharper knife.)

The handle isn't as wide or as rounded as I had hoped, so it is uncomfortable against the palm of my hand. Also, the metal neck (between blade & handle) hurts my fingers when I hold it. I probably won't use it much, if at all.
